Types ¶
type Evaluator ¶
type Evaluator interface {
// Fetch populates the values map being passed into it by translating input expressions into a series of
// parser.MetricRequest and fetching the raw data from the configured backend.
//
// It returns a map of only the data requested in the current invocation, scaled to a common step.
Fetch(ctx context.Context, e []parser.Expr, from, until int64, values map[parser.MetricRequest][]*types.MetricData) (map[parser.MetricRequest][]*types.MetricData, error)
// Eval uses the raw data within the values map being passed into it to in order to evaluate the input expression.
Eval(ctx context.Context, e parser.Expr, from, until int64, values map[parser.MetricRequest][]*types.MetricData) ([]*types.MetricData, error)
}
Evaluator is an interface for any existing expression parser.
type Function ¶
type Function interface {
Do(ctx context.Context, evaluator Evaluator, e parser.Expr, from, until int64, values map[parser.MetricRequest][]*types.MetricData) ([]*types.MetricData, error)
Description() map[string]types.FunctionDescription
}
Function is interface that all graphite functions should follow

type RewriteFunction ¶
type RewriteFunction interface {
Do(ctx context.Context, evaluator Evaluator, e parser.Expr, from, until int64, values map[parser.MetricRequest][]*types.MetricData) (bool, []string, error)
Description() map[string]types.FunctionDescription
}
RewriteFunction is interface that graphite functions that rewrite expressions should follow
